LEARN TO WAIT by ANONYMOUS

First Line: LEARN TO WAIT - LIFE'S HARDEST LESSON
Last Line: JOY SEEKS NOT A BRIGHTER MORROW; / ONLY SAD HEARTS LEARN TO WAIT
Subject(s): PATIENCE;

Learn to wait -- life's hardest lesson
Conned, perchance, through blinding tears;
While the heart throbs sadly echo
To the tread of passing years.
Learn to wait -- hope's slow fruition;
Faint not, though the way seems long;
There is joy in each condition;
Hearts through suffering may grow strong.
Thus a soul untouched by sorrow
Aims not at a higher state;
Joy seeks not a brighter morrow;
Only sad hearts learn to wait.
